Running server based vb.net app through Progress

by westcott41@[EMAIL PROTECTED] May 4, 2007 at 08:03 AM

Hello,
    I hope that I can explain this well.  My company bought a software
package that uses Progress as it's language.  We would like to add
more functionality to the software by writing small apps in vb.net to
fill the needs the software doesn't provide.  I have already worked
with the progress databases.

   What I need is to have the Progress app call a .exe file that I
have written.

1. I need it to pass information to my app.(I can do through txt file
if needed)
2. Progress app is a client/server app( should it be installed and
executed through server or client?)
3.How would I call this app for client/server.

I hope someone out there has done this type of interaction before.
